We are looking for a Certification Officer to join our busy specialist team. In this role, you will be responsible for reviews and investigations into high-risk and non-compliance areas within the vehicle certification sector. Drawing on your vehicle certification experience and excellent knowledge of Vehicle Inspection Requirement Manuals (VIRM), you will regularly visit and engage with regulated parties in the Auckland region to ensure they meet compliance and legislative requirements. You will need to produce high-quality reports based on your visits, including findings and the implementation of statutory interventions and other regulatory activities. Reporting involves updating spreadsheets to track your findings and ensuring timely outcomes to enhance safety and compliance. Travel across Auckland and the wider region for site visits is required.
